Winston and Julia
Julia, the thought police heard every word we’ve said.
There is a chopper near the window to chop off our head.
I believe we are just as good as dead.
There was a television screen hidden behind the picture on the wall.
Big brother was watching and listening to it all.
I can hear their heavy boots as they are coming up the stairs.
What about our inevitable fate? I don’t think any of them cares.
I should never have trusted O’Brien. We have been betrayed.
Yes, they caught us and will take us away, I’m afraid.
Based on the novel "1984" by the late George Orwell
